Mercury Bird

Contributed by dafremen on Tuesday, 29th July 2003 @ 11:05:00 PM in AEST
Topic: DreamsandWishes



Mercury Bird
R. Dafremen

Fly away Mercury Bird, fly away
Why don't you fly?
Leave the disappointing earth
And chase the morning sky
The dawn that marks your way
Still shakes the cobwebs from your dreams
And by and by
The grim reality still makes you cry.

Don't believe them Mercury Bird, don't believe them
Don't you believe the lies
Don't believe there are no faery hearts
No glowing dragon's eyes
You know different my friend
Go the distance my friend
Embrace the wonderment
That filled your eyes before
You were so wise before
So like a child before
Seems like skepticism brought you down
You used to fly so free
In days gone by you see
Before they snuck up on your heart and tied you down.

Now fly away to find that rainbow's end
Fly away to find that outstretched hand
Which doesn't reach to snatch your dreams
The one that will not clip your wings
Or hold you here
Upon the gloomy ground
Won't hold you down
Someone to watch you soar
Until the evening's coldness comes along
A warm inviting heart
That patient, listens for your song
A love in which to stow your wings
Til starlit slumber brings the day
A place to rest
Until the morning's dewdrops
Call you out to play
A voice that gentle speaks the words
Which you have longed to hear them say
"I'll wait here for you sweet bird, now
Fly away."
